Transaction 6173515389c289831e254dbb37bf7989b38266e1c2bbc3873aa4b17b6c7da4e2
1 Input
1 Output
-
6173515389c289831e254dbb37bf7989b38266e1c2bbc3873aa4b17b6c7da4e2:0
- value
- 48331
- script pubkey
- OP_0 OP_PUSHBYTES_20 8129631df26cc1ce3cc32e3629815cde1a9b26ed
- address
- bc1qsy5kx80jdnquu0xr9cmznq2umcdfkfhdeajxpp